Features:
Large screen: SpO2,PR are shown on LED screen, Pleth waveform is displayed on 3.5" LCD screen in real time
Light in weight, only 1kg with battery
72-hour data storage, 100-item patient ID
72-hour SpO2 and PR spot graphs
3-level visual & audio alarm
Intellectual control of power consumption, internal rechargeable battery lasts 24 hours or AC power
Battery-low indication
Built-in thermal recorder(optional)
Suitable for adult, pediatric and neonatal
Widely used in small clinic, all departments in hospital, ambulance
Compatible with CHOICE central monitoring system
USB data upload (optional)
Anti-high-frequency electrosurgical equipment

FAQ's of Pulse Oximeter System:
Q: How does the Pulse Oximeter System work?
A: The device operates using photoplethysmographic (PPG) sensor technology to non-invasively measure blood oxygen saturation and pulse rate. Just place your fingertip in the sensor, and the system provides real-time readings within 8 seconds on its OLED display.
Q: What are the benefits of the visual and sound alarm functions?
A: The alarms immediately notify you if SpO2 or pulse rate readings are abnormal, allowing for prompt response. This feature helps ensure user safety during both personal and clinical use, reducing risks associated with unnoticed hypoxemia or irregular pulse rates.
